Ok my new toy is here . 66 Mustang Coupe, just purchased it from Sheparton and got it shipped over to WA.
Its unrego'd at the moment, going over the pits on Friday and I believe it was imported in 1996 by Mustangs of Melbourne.
Biggest issue is the car is too low. I don't think its gunna pass but It will be close. Also drivers door doesn't work. If i can only work out how to get the door handle off (I guess its a circlup behind the handle..
